Since hurricane Francis and Jeanne devastated our coast the last two months, there have been several reports in the media of finds on Satellite Beach. I live and work in Satellite Beach and detect with my Excalibur on a regular basis, and have never found any indication that any Spanish galleon sank off of our beaches. The simple fact is that the closest 1715 wreck was the Nuestra Senora de la Concepcion that went down off the southern shoal of Cape Canaveral, and was the only ship of the fleet that has not yet been found that was carrying any treasure.
